NEW YORK, July 10, 2014 /PRNewswire/ -- For a third straight year, Lou Eccleston, President, S&P Capital IQ, and Chairman of the Board, S&P Dow Jones Indices, has been named by Institutional Investor among its "Tech 50", a prestigious list of financial services industry leaders at the forefront of financial technology innovation. The list appears in the magazine's current issue. In Institutional Investor's latest ranking, Eccleston moves up from #27 in 2013 to #21 in 2014.

Noting Institutional Investor's recognition of S&P Capital IQ's development of its own code, called IQ Language, for unlocking the power of its data with differentiated analytics, Eccleston said, "This award is a testament to the enormous amount of transformational and innovative work our entire organization has accomplished in the last three years. In addition, it is an important acknowledgement of the talented and creative technology team we have built. Together, we are developing new technologies and products that will provide our clients with the analytics power to capitalize on opportunities and manage risk."

The "Tech 50" ranking was compiled by Institutional Investor's editors and staff, with nominations and input from industry participants and experts. Four primary sets of attributes are evaluated: achievements and contributions over the course of a career; scope and complexity of responsibilities; influence and leadership inside and outside the organization; and pure technological innovation.
